WebJul 6, 2024 · Short for Self-Monitoring Analysis and Reporting Technology, S.M.A.R.T., or SMART, is a diagnostic method originally developed by IBM and introduced with the ATA-3 specification. At that time, S.M.A.R.T. was referred to as Predictive Failure Analysis. This technology was initially developed for IBM mainframe drives to give advanced warning of ... When SMART failure predicts on the hard drive it … WebMar 20, 2024 · Your typical SSD will survive many years of typical home use before it is at a considerable risk of failure. Exactly how long it’ll last depends largely on how much data is written to the drive, as well as the drive’s age and the ambient conditions. WebMar 19, 2024 · Here's a look at four leading causes of SSD failure and how to resolve the problems. 1. Heat. While NVMe SSDs are the new kid on the block, the problem that plagues them the most is one of the oldest in computing: heat.
